How much do people at Metropolitan water get paid? See the latest salaries by department and job title. The average estimated annual salary, including base and bonus, at Metropolitan water is $87,414, or $42 per hour, while the estimated median salary is $102,206, or $49 per hour.
At Metropolitan water, the highest paid job is a Sales Rep at $114,659 annually and the lowest is a Bookkeeper at $41,338 annually. Average Metropolitan water salaries by department include: Admin at $53,215, Finance at $73,025, Business Development at $101,511, and Customer Support at $58,039. Half of Metropolitan water salaries are above $102,206.
